The other day I was sitting outside and eating my lunch while simultaneously doing my reading for class, and I inadvertently dropped a whole Dorito chip on the ground. The next thing I knew the ground was littered with hundreds of tiny little ants--yuck! but then I felt like God was saying that this is what the Church is supposed to look like. Not look like ants literally... but there were so many of them under the chip and on the sides that they were able to move it into the grass! I was amazed that they were able to do such a thing without even talking to each other--and yet we as humans, having the gift of speech, still have such issues communicating! But anyway, I was also thinking about their unity in task. And the same goes for us. If we are to carry out the Great Commission, if we are to bring the Kingdom here, if we are to bring love and grace to a world that doesn't know it, two of us who are really excited cannot do it on our own. We have to be unified in the goal and as the body of Christ, together seek to move that Dorito chip. Maybe that's why Jesus was praying for unity for us in John 17.
